CSF
Cerebrospinal Fluid, a clear, colorless bodily fluid that fills the brain's ventricles and surrounds the central nervous system, acting as a cushion and participating in nutrient transport and waste removal.
Ventricles
Cavities within the brain that produce and contain cerebrospinal fluid, which helps protect and nourish the brain.
Frontal Lobe
The largest of the four major lobes of the brain, located at the front of each hemisphere, involved in voluntary movement, expressive language, and managing higher level executive functions.
Decision Making
The cognitive process of choosing between different courses of action or belief, often involving weighing the benefits and risks.
